Understanding Conventional Aspects of Funeral Programs
When preparing a funeral program, recognizing the conventional elements is critical, as these parts assist recognize the dead and supply convenience to participants.
Generally, a program consists of an order of service, noting essential occasions like the opening remarks, readings, and eulogies. You'll usually find a brief obituary that commemorates the individual's life, along with pictures that capture treasured memories.
Including hymns or tracks is additionally common, as these choices can evoke emotions and foster reflection. In addition, you might intend to offer space for recommendations, allowing the family to give thanks to those that've supported them.
Incorporating Personal Touches and Special Information
Including individual touches and special information into the funeral program can change it right into a heartfelt tribute that really shows the individual being recognized.
Think of including their favorite colors, hobbies, or quotes that resonate with their individuality. You may include photos from considerable minutes in their life and even a tiny section highlighting their achievements and passions.
Consider utilizing personalized pictures or signs that represent their trip, developing a tangible connection to their heritage. You might also invite family members or good friends to share brief anecdotes, making the program a collective initiative.
These individual components not only improve the program's aesthetic but additionally commemorate the essence of the individual, making each program a distinct testament to a life well-lived.
